SET-UP LOCATION
* Keep your notebook and all connected peripherals away from
moisture, dust, heat and direct sunlight. Failure to do so
can lead to Notebook malfunction or damage.
* It is highly recommended you do not use the notebook out-
doors.
* Operate the notebook and all peripherals on a stable, bal-
anced and vibration-free surface.
* Do not leave the base of your notebook on your lap or any
part of your body for a long period of time. The notebook can
become very warm while it is turned on or charging and can
cause discomfort or injury from heat exposure.
AMBIENT TEMPERATURE
* The notebook is most reliably operated at an ambient tem-
perature between +41° and +104° F and at a relative humid-
ity between 20% and 70% (without condensation).
* When powered off, the notebook can be stored at tempera-
tures between 32° and 140° F.
* Wait until the notebook has reached ambient (room) tem-
perature before turning it on or connecting it to the power
adapter. Drastic variations in temperature and humidity can
create condensation within the PC and may cause it to short-
circuit.
* For transporting the notebook keep the original packing.
